Risks and Considerations
While there can be many advantages to playing at non UK licensed casinos, it’s essential to consider the associated risks:
- Lack of consumer protection: Non UK casinos may not provide the same level of player protection as those regulated by the UK Gambling Commission. This means that recourse in case of disputes may be limited.
- Payment issues: Some players have reported difficulties in withdrawing funds from non UK licensed casinos. It can be more challenging to resolve payment disputes without proper regulatory oversight.
- General trust issues: Without a well-known regulatory body overseeing operations, players may find it difficult to determine the trustworthiness of these casinos. Doing thorough research and looking for reviews can help mitigate these concerns.
